About dental care

Dental disease is one of the most common problems seen in dogs and cats. Routine dental checks, professional cleaning (scale and polish) and, where needed, extractions help keep your pet comfortable and healthy.

Most first-opinion practices assess dental health at routine check-ups and offer dental procedures under anaesthetic. Ask about signs to watch for, such as bad breath, or difficulty eating.

How do I know if my pet needs dental treatment?

Bad breath, discoloured teeth, red gums or reluctance to eat can all be signs. A vet can assess your pet’s teeth at a routine check-up.

Is a dental done under anaesthetic?

Professional cleaning and extractions are usually carried out under general anaesthetic so the vet can examine and treat every tooth safely.
